免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

ios证书培训

iOS证书是苹果公司用于验证和授权iOS应用程序的一种安全机制。苹果公司要求所有发布在App Store上的应用程序都必须使用有效的证书进行签名,以确保应用程序的安全性和可靠性。在本文中,我们将介绍iOS证书的原理和详细信息。

iOS证书的原理

iOS证书主要是用于认证和授权开发人员和应用程序。它们是由苹果公司颁发的数字证书,用于验证应用程序的身份和完整性。iOS证书包括开发证书、发布证书和推送证书。

开发证书是用于开发iOS应用程序的证书,它用于验证开发人员的身份和授权他们使用苹果开发工具,如Xcode、iOS SDK等。开发证书包括开发者身份验证证书和开发者私钥,它们被用于签署iOS应用程序。

发布证书是用于发布iOS应用程序的证书,它用于验证应用程序的身份和完整性。发布证书包括发布者身份验证证书和发布者私钥,它们被用于签署iOS应用程序并上传到App Store。

推送证书是用于推送通知到iOS设备的证书,它用于验证应用程序的身份和授权应用程序发送推送通知。推送证书包括推送身份验证证书和推送私钥,它们被用于发送推送通知。

iOS证书的详细介绍

iOS证书包括开发证书、发布证书和推送证书。下面我们将对每种证书进行详细介绍。

开发证书

开发证书是用于开发iOS应用程序的证书。它是由苹果公司颁发的数字证书,用于验证开发人员的身份和授权他们使用苹果开发工具,如Xcode、iOS SDK等。

开发证书包括开发者身份验证证书和开发者私钥。开发者身份验证证书是一个数字证书,用于验证开发人员的身份。开发者私钥是一个密钥对,用于签署iOS应用程序。

开发证书的创建需要以下步骤:

1. 注册苹果开发者账号:在苹果开发者网站上注册一个账号,这个账号可以用于开发iOS应用程序和发布应用程序。

2. 创建开发证书请求:在Mac电脑上使用Keychain Access工具创建一个证书请求。证书请求包括开发者的姓名和电子邮件地址。

3. 提交证书请求:将证书请求提交到苹果开发者网站上,苹果公司会对开发者的身份进行验证,并颁发开发证书。

4. 下载开发证书:苹果公司颁发开发证书后,开发者可以在苹果开发者网站上下载开发证书并安装到Mac电脑上。

发布证书

发布证书是用于发布iOS应用程序的证书。它是由苹果公司颁发的数字证书,用于验证应用程序的身份和完整性。

发布证书包括发布者身份验证证书和发布者私钥。发布者身份验证证书是一个数字证书,用于验证应用程序的身份。发布者私钥是一个密钥对,用于签署iOS应用程序并上传到App Store。

发布证书的创建需要以下步骤:

1. 注册苹果开发者账号:在苹果开发者网站上注册一个账号,这个账号可以用于开发iOS应用程序和发布应用程序。

2. 创建发布证书请求:在Mac电脑上使用Keychain Access工具创建一个证书请求。证书请求包括发布者的姓名和电子邮件地址。

3. 提交证书请求:将证书请求提交到苹果开发者网站上,苹果公司会对发布者的身份进行验证,并颁发发布证书。

4. 下载发布证书:苹果公司颁发发布证书后,发布者可以在苹果开发者网站上下载发布证书并安装到Mac电脑上。

推送证书

推送证书是用于推送通知到iOS设备的证书。它是由苹果公司颁发的数字证书,用于验证应用程序的身份和授权应用程序发送推送通知。

推送证书包括推送身份验证证书和推送私钥。推送身份验证证书是


相关知识:
苹果证书在线签名
苹果证书在线签名是指将应用程序或插件打包成IPA或者Plist文件后,使用苹果开发者证书进行签名,以便于在iOS设备上进行安装和使用。该技术主要应用于企业内部应用、开发者的测试应用、以及一些需要自主分发的应用。苹果证书在线签名的原理主要包括以下几个方面:1
2023-04-07
苹果签名经验分享
苹果签名是指在苹果设备上安装的应用程序需要经过苹果官方认证并获得签名后才能够正常运行。这样做的目的是为了保护用户的设备安全和隐私,避免恶意软件和病毒的入侵。苹果签名的原理是通过数字证书对应用程序进行签名,确保其来源和完整性。本文将详细介绍苹果签名的原理和相
2023-04-07
苹果权限证书
苹果权限证书是一种由苹果公司颁发的数字证书,用于授权开发者在苹果设备上安装和运行某些软件或应用程序。这些证书是苹果公司为了保障iOS和macOS系统的安全性和稳定性而推出的,可以有效遏制恶意软件和病毒的传播。苹果权限证书的原理是基于公钥加密技术,使用数字签
2023-04-07
苹果开发证书那点事
苹果开发证书是一种数字证书,用于验证开发者的身份和授权开发者使用苹果的开发工具和服务。本文将介绍苹果开发证书的原理和详细介绍。一、证书的原理数字证书是一种用于验证身份和交换密钥的数字文件。它是一种基于公钥密码学的技术,用于确保通信的安全性和完整性。数字证书
2023-04-07
苹果为什么没有信任证书
苹果没有信任证书的原因是因为其操作系统(iOS和macOS)默认信任由苹果公司颁发的数字证书,因此不需要用户手动安装或信任其他证书。这些数字证书用于验证应用程序、网站和其他网络服务的身份和完整性,以确保它们是合法的和安全的。数字证书是一种用于验证和保护网络
2023-04-07
苹果ipa签名好修改吗
苹果ipa签名是指将应用程序打包成ipa文件,并使用苹果公司颁发的数字证书进行签名,以确保应用程序的安全性和完整性。通过签名,苹果公司可以验证应用程序的来源,并防止应用程序被恶意篡改或修改。因此,修改ipa签名是不被允许的,而且也是非常困难的。首先,我们需
2023-04-07
ios证书类型功能详细介绍
iOS证书是用于验证和授权应用程序的一种数字证书。在iOS开发中,通常需要使用证书来签署应用程序、进行调试和发布应用程序。本文将详细介绍iOS证书的类型和功能。1. 开发者证书开发者证书是用于在开发阶段对应用程序进行签名和调试的证书。开发者证书由苹果公司颁
2023-04-07
ios掉证书的应用怎么安装
iOS掉证书是指由于苹果公司对于开发者账号的限制和审核,导致开发者的应用在一定时间后无法继续使用。此时,用户需要通过一些方法来安装应用程序,以继续使用它们。下面就为大家介绍一下iOS掉证书的应用怎么安装的原理和详细步骤。一、原理iOS掉证书的应用安装,其实
2023-04-07
ios开发证书管理
iOS开发证书管理是指在开发iOS应用程序时,为了能够在真机上进行调试和测试,需要使用苹果公司提供的开发证书。开发证书是一种数字证书,用于验证开发者身份和应用程序的真实性。本文将详细介绍iOS开发证书管理的原理和流程。一、证书概述iOS开发证书分为开发证书
2023-04-07
ios13自签证书
iOS 13自签证书是指用户自己创建并安装的数字证书,用于在iOS设备上安装未经过苹果官方认证的应用程序。这种证书的原理是在iOS设备上安装一个自定义的根证书,然后使用该根证书签署应用程序,从而使得设备可以信任并安装未经过苹果官方认证的应用程序。自签证书的
2023-04-07
ios10升级证书
iOS 10升级证书是指将设备的数字证书更新为新版本的过程。数字证书是一种用于验证设备身份和授权使用的安全凭证。在iOS设备中,数字证书用于验证设备的身份、授权应用程序的使用、保护隐私和加密通信等。因此,更新证书对于保证设备的安全性和使用体验非常重要。iO
2023-04-07
app申请ios证书踩得坑
iOS证书是开发者在发布应用程序时必须使用的一种文件,它可以使应用程序在苹果设备上运行。但是,在申请iOS证书的过程中,开发者经常会遇到各种各样的问题和困难。本文将详细介绍如何申请iOS证书并避免常见的坑。一、什么是iOS证书?iOS证书是由苹果公司颁发的
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4